KOHIMA, APRIL 4
The 4th Altrura Open football tournament, under the aegis of Altrura Society got underway today, on the theme, ‘Goal for Unity’ at Medziphema Town Local Ground with Kuolachalie Seyie, Chairman Sanitation & Env Committee, Businessman and Social Worker as the special guest of the opening ceremony.
While acknowledging Altrura Society for working with a sense of difference with its whole purpose is to serve and not to be served, Kuolachalie in his inaugural speech said that the initiatives for the youth capacity building is commendable and a positive contribution to our society. He also stresses on the importance and benefit of sports and football as it fosters and promote unity through discipline.

Earlier the program was compered by Information & Publicity Secretary Altrura Society (AuS) Neivikho Savi while Pastor Medziphema Town Baptist Church Keviuchülie Mezhü pronounced the invocation. The keynote address was delivered by President AuS Megosielie Kruse and greetings by Chairman Medziphema Village Neikhonyü Kuotsu.
The gathering was enthralled with a special number presented by Kezhalesie Kuotsu, oath taking by assistant games & sports secy. AuS Shurhotsilie and vote of thanks delivered by Mhasileto Medoze, Advisor AuS.
Altogether 32 teams from different parts of Nagaland are participating in this year tournament. The opening match was played between Legend Club Cmd vs Jharnapani Youth Organization.
